Handover — Petra to incoming starters. Goods lift at Calderholt Yard is for deliveries only, 07:00–15:00. Do not ride it with visitors. Pallets go straight to bay C; flatten cartons before the 14:00 waste run. If the lift alarms, call the duty engineer, don't reset it yourself. Keys for the lift lobby hang at the desk. The lift control panel unlocks with the badge code below.

staff pass of kawep-hahap = bdg-IEUUF-6

Runbook: Gatehouse rate limiting. Our internal gateway, Gatehouse, applies a token-bucket limiter per client app. Defaults are 200 req/min, configurable in limits.yaml. If a team screams about 429s, check their bucket config before raising anything — nine times out of ten they forgot backoff. Overrides require a restart of the Gatehouse pods in the Tarnwick cluster. To authenticate override pushes, the deploy script reads an admin token from the env file; add it on the next line.

vault entry, yahif-yajep: COURIER_KEY29=b802bdf8034096b65a51c6ba5abe2

## Changelog — Lattice UI kit 9.0

For the eng sync: defaults changed for shared component versioning. Lattice now pins consumers to exact versions instead of caret ranges. Rationale: three incidents last quarter from silent minor bumps breaking the Foxhall dashboard. Auto-upgrade is off by default; renovation bot opens PRs instead. Teams wanting the old behavior must opt in explicitly. Nothing changes for apps already pinned. New consumers scaffolded after this release pick up the following defaults:

settings of tagef-bawif:
DRUIX_HOST=druix.zemvarlabs.internal
DRUIX_PORT=8000